#ab328c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ab328c is composed of 67.1% red, 19.6%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.8% magenta, 18.1%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 315.4 degrees, a saturation of 54.8% and a lightness of 43.3%. #ab328c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ff64ff with #570019.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#ab328c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ab328c has RGB values of R:171, G:50,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.18,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11219596.

Shades and Tints of #ab328c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040103 is the darkest color, while #fcf4f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#ab328c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706e6f is the less saturated color, while #d607a1 is the most saturated one.
